Chassis, Suspension, Brakes & Wheels

FrametypeCrMo Steel tubular trellis and magnesium alloy
FrontbrakesDouble disc
Frontbrakesdiameter310 mm (12.2 inches)
FrontsuspensionUpside-down telescopic hydraulic fork with rebound-compression damping and spring preload adjustment
Fronttyre120/65-ZR17
RearbrakesSingle disc
Rearbrakesdiameter221 mm (8.7 inches)
RearsuspensionProgressive, single shock absorber with rebound compression damping and spring preload
Reartyre190/50-ZR17
Trail98 mm (3.9 inches)

Engine & Transmission

ClutchWet, Multi-plate
Compression12.0:1
CoolingsystemLiquid
Displacement748.93 ccm (45.70 cubic inches)
EnginedetailsIn-line four, four-stroke
FuelsystemInjection. Multipoint electronic injection
Gearbox6-speed
Power125.25 HP (91.4 kW)) @ 12500 RPM
TransmissiontypefinaldriveChain

Physical Measures & Capacities

Groundclearance130 mm (5.1 inches)

At the heart of the Brutale America is its powerful 748.93 ccm in-line four engine, which churns out an impressive 125.25 HP at a thrilling 12,500 RPM. This high-revving engine delivers a visceral riding experience, characterized by immediate throttle response and a spine-tingling exhaust note. The liquid-cooled, four-stroke powerplant is complemented by a six-speed gearbox, ensuring smooth gear changes and optimal power delivery. Whether you’re carving through winding roads or cruising down the boulevard, the Brutale America offers a ride that is both exhilarating and dynamic, making it a favorite among spirited riders.

Equipped with a lightweight CrMo steel tubular trellis frame and magnesium alloy components, the Brutale America offers remarkable agility and stability. The front suspension features an upside-down telescopic hydraulic fork with adjustable rebound-compression damping and spring preload, allowing riders to fine-tune their setup for maximum comfort and control. The braking system is equally impressive, featuring double discs at the front (310 mm) and a single disc at the rear (221 mm), providing ample stopping power to match its spirited performance. With a ground clearance of 130 mm and a trail of 98 mm, this bike is engineered for precision handling, making it a joy to ride in any condition.
